/**
* @test
* @bug 6239117
* @summary test logical channels work
* @author Andreas Sterbenz
* @ignore requires special hardware
* @run main/manual TestExclusive
*/
import java.io.*;
import java.util.*;
import javax.smartcardio.*;
public class TestChannel extends Utils {
static final byte[] c1 = parse("00 A4 04 00 07 A0 00 00 00 62 81 01 00");
static final byte[] r1 = parse("07:a0:00:00:00:62:81:01:04:01:00:00:24:05:00:0b:04:b0:55:90:00");
// static final byte[] r1 = parse("07 A0 00 00 00 62 81 01 04 01 00 00 24 05 00 0B 04 B0 25 90 00");
static final byte[] openChannel = parse("00 70 00 00 01");
static final byte[] closeChannel = new byte[] {0x01, 0x70, (byte)0x80, 0};
public static void main(String[] args) throws Exception {
CardTerminal terminal = getTerminal(args);
// establish a connection with the card
Card card = terminal.connect("T=0");
System.out.println("card: " + card);
CardChannel basicChannel = card.getBasicChannel();
try {
basicChannel.transmit(new CommandAPDU(openChannel));
} catch (IllegalArgumentException e) {
System.out.println("OK: " + e);
}
try {
basicChannel.transmit(new CommandAPDU(closeChannel));
} catch (IllegalArgumentException e) {
System.out.println("OK: " + e);
}
byte[] atr = card.getATR().getBytes();
System.out.println("atr: " + toString(atr));
// semi-accurate test to see if the card appears to support logical channels
boolean supportsChannels = false;
for (int i = 0; i < atr.length; i++) {
if (atr[i] == 0x73) {
supportsChannels = true;
break;
}
}
if (supportsChannels == false) {
System.out.println("Card does not support logical channels, skipping...");
} else {
CardChannel channel = card.openLogicalChannel();
System.out.println("channel: " + channel);
/*
// XXX bug in Oberthur card??
System.out.println("Transmitting...");
transmitTestCommand(channel);
System.out.println("OK");
/**/
channel.close();
}
// disconnect
card.disconnect(false);
System.out.println("OK.");
}
}
